Spanish

edit

Etymology

edit

From Latin suggerō.

Pronunciation

edit
  • IPA(key): /suxeˈɾiɾ/ [su.xeˈɾiɾ]
  • Rhymes: -iɾ
  • Syllabification: su‧ge‧rir

Verb

edit

sugerir (first-person singular present sugiero, first-person singular preterite sugerí, past participle sugerido)

  1. to suggest
